3. Description of Service
ePipra provides an AI-powered advertising automation and unified media buying platform designed for performance marketers, native media buyers, search arbitrage operators, affiliate networks, and media buying agencies. The Service includes:
Unified Campaign Hub
Single dashboard to create, manage, and monitor advertising campaigns across 15+ traffic sources including Facebook, TikTok, Snap, Pinterest, X, Taboola, Outbrain, MGID, and more.
Meta API Automation
Programmatic creation, testing, scaling, and pausing of Meta (Facebook/Instagram) advertising campaigns via the Meta Marketing API — including $1/day hook testing, budget automation, and bidding rules.
RSOC & Search Arbitrage
SearchCore module for keyword optimisation, bulk testing, RPC uplift, and full feed management across Google RSOC, Yahoo, Bing, Sedo, System1, Tonic, Bodis, and Predicto.
Creative & Team Management
Centralised creative asset library, bulk variation, performance optimisation, affiliate management, role-based team permissions, and alerts and notifications at scale.
ePipra’s core activities include search monetisation, search arbitrage, content arbitrage, extension and app development, and AI-powered advertising automation. The Service supports campaign types including but not limited to search arbitrage, e-commerce, lead generation, and content monetisation.
